exercices corrigés codage crc
1 Correction de lexercice CRC
1 Correction de l'exercice CRC Lorsque le récepteur recevra ce message il pourra vérifier qu'il n'y a pas d'erreur en retransformant ce code binaire en |
Codes Correcteurs dErreurs Série de TD n03 Ex -1
Ex -1- : Codage canal : Code en bloc Pouvoir de correction Distance de Hamming Significant Bit) un CRC (Code Reduncy Cyclic) calculé par le biais du |
Codes correcteurs
Code CRC -Exemple 13 Code CRC -Polynômes générateurs 15 Exercices Après correction ce |
Codes détecteurs et correcteurs B Rouzeyre
Code de Hamming Codes cycliques CRC/FCS code BCH Reed-Salomon Page 4 Introduction ▫ Erreurs lors de la transmission ▫ Information découpée en blocs |
TD : Code et détection derreur
1 Calculez le bloc de contrôle d'erreurs (CRC) correspondant `a la suite de bits M en utilisant le polynôme d'erreur G( |
TD Réseau Les codes correcteurs et les codes détecteurs Claude
Le code de Hamming : un code détecteur et correcteur d'erreurs Le CRC (Cycle Le CRC (6) Exercices : On utilisera le polynôme générateur x 4 + x2 + x 1 |
TD2
2 1 Calcul du CRC d'une séquence binaire Calculer le CRC associé à la séquence binaire 00101101011 avec les polynômes générateurs G(x) = x5 + x2 + 1 et G(x) |
Comment se calcule le CRC ?
Le CRC (3)
4 +x2 +x, on obtient 10110.
On ajoute m zéros au mot binaire à transmettre où m est le degré du polynôme générateur. 4 + x2 + x, on obtient alors 111001110000.
On va ajouter itérativement à ce mot, le mot correspondant au polynôme générateur jusqu'à ce que le mot obtenu soit inférieur au polynôme générateur.Pourquoi ajoute on le CRC d'un message au message Lui-même ?
Introduction▲ CRC veut dire Cyclic Redundancy Code Le calcul de CRC permet au récepteur d'un message de verifier que les données transmises ne contiennent pas d'erreurs.
Pour faire cela, l'émetteur du message calcule une valeur "CheckSum" qui est fonction du contenu du message, puis l'ajoute à la fin du message.Comment trouver le polynôme générateur ?
Le mot de code m(x) d'un code polynômial (k, n) de polynôme générateur g(x) associé au mot initial i(x) est défini par : m(x) = i(x). xn-k + r(x), où r(x) est le reste de la division de i(x). xn-k par le polynôme générateur g(x) (noté : r(x) = (i(x).
- Le CRC (contrôle de redondance cyclique) est utilisé pour détecter les erreurs dans les réseaux numériques.
Les CRC sont également exécutés sur certains types de supports de stockage informatique.
L'objectif spécifique d'un CRC est de s'assurer qu'il n'y a pas de modifications accidentelles des données.
TD Réseau Les codes correcteurs et les codes détecteurs Claude
Le code de Hamming : un code détecteur et correcteur d'erreurs. Le CRC (Cycle Redundancy Check) : un code détecteur d'erreurs. Année 2003-2004 – p.3/22 |
TD2 - Correction des exercices 1 Somme de contrôle (Checksum) |
EXERCICES CORRIGES SUR LES RESEAUX ETHERNET Exercice
EXERCICES CORRIGES SUR LES RESEAUX ETHERNET. Exercice n°1 CRC (Cyclic Redundancy Check) Ethernet est basé sur le codage Manchester (simple). |
TD : Code et détection derreur |
Protocoles réseaux TD no 1 : Codes détecteurs Codes correcteurs
Un code est une fonction C qui a tout mot de m bits associe un mot de n bits n>m. Exercice 2 : bit de parité ... Exercice 3 : codes CRC. 1. Coder ... |
Chapitre12_IFT1215.ps (mpage)
sans les bits de contrôle le message corrigé est 1001. 6. CODES CORRECTEURS. CODE DE HAMMING. Exemple 8 Bits d'info + 4 Bits de contrôle |
Exercices-modbus.pdf
Adresse de l'esclave. Code fonction. Mot de contrôle (CRC). Exercice n°3. Décoder le message « réponse n°2 » émis par l'esclave en complétant le tableau. |
Version consolidée du règlement CRC 99-02 au 1
définis à l'article L.526-3 du code monétaire et financier ; 25 – Informations à porter dans l'annexe de l'exercice où intervient la modification du ... |
TD2 - Calculs de code de contrôle derreurs
On se propose d'utiliser l'idée de l'exercice précédent de façon un peu plus Le code CRC va utiliser une clef et réaliser un calcul pour obtenir un code ... |
Exercices dirigés Réseaux et protocoles
On considère le code polynomial sur 14 bits généré par le polynôme correcteur d'erreurs par quel message doit il être corrigé (quel est le message. |
TD Réseau Les codes correcteurs et les codes détecteurs Claude
un code détecteur et correcteur d'erreurs Le CRC (Cycle Redundancy Check) : Exercice : y a-t-il une erreur dans le mot suivant ? |
Codes correcteurs
sans les bits de contrôle le message corrigé est 1001 6 CODES CORRECTEURS CODE DE HAMMING Exemple 8 Bits d'info + 4 Bits de contrôle parité paire |
TD2 - Correction des exercices 1 Somme de contrôle (Checksum)
2 Code de Redondance Cyclique (Cyclic Redundancy Check) 2 1 Calcul du CRC d'une séquence binaire Calculer le CRC associé à la séquence binaire 00101101011 |
TD : Code et détection derreur
Calculez le bloc de contrôle d'erreurs (CRC) correspondant `a la suite de bits M en utilisant le polynôme d'erreur G(x) = x4 + x3 + x1 + 1 M = 1 1 0 0 1 0 1 0 |
Corrigé Exercice 1: 1a : P X = = C p 1 ? p = 012345 1b - LIRMM
Corrigé Exercice 1: 1 a : P X = = C p 1 ? p = 012345 1 b : L'erreur est détectée lorsque le nombre de bits erronés est 1 2 3ou 4 c-?à-?d |
Codes détecteurs et correcteurs B Rouzeyre - LIRMM
J Badrikian Technosup Ellipses (cours et exercices) Conclusion : si on détecte une erreur on corrige vers le code demandant le moins de changements |
TD2 - Calculs de code de contrôle derreurs
Exercice 4 (Bonus CRC) Le code CRC va utiliser une clef et réaliser un calcul pour obtenir un code similaire à celui du bit de parité mais plus |
Protocoles réseaux TD no 1 : Codes détecteurs - Irif
Transmettre A divisé par Xr Exercice 3 : codes CRC 1 Coder 0110010 puis 011101000111101 avec le polynome X4 + X + 1 2 Décoder 11010111 puis |
Cours & TD Les Codes Correcteurs Et Les Codes Détecteurs Derreurs
CRC Le Code de Hamming Claude Duvallet — 4/17 TD 2 - Les codes correcteurset les codes Codage Canal V2 pdf Exercices corrigés sur la fibre optique |
Codes Correcteurs dErreurs Série de TD n03 Ex -1 - ensao
Ex -1- : Codage canal : Code en bloc Pouvoir de correction Distance de Hamming Significant Bit) un CRC (Code Reduncy Cyclic) calculé par le biais du |
Comment calculer le code CRC ?
. Un polynôme CRC nommé C(X) est un sous ensemble des polynômes P(x).
Comment utiliser un CRC en émission ?
. En réception : le message reçu qui contient les données et le CRC doit être divisible par le polynôme générateur.
Comment fonctionne le code de Hamming ?
. Il permet la détection et la correction automatique d'une erreur si elle ne porte que sur une lettre du message.
. Un code de Hamming est parfait : pour une longueur de code donnée il n'existe pas d'autre code plus compact ayant la même capacité de correction.
Comment calculer le code de Hamming ?
TD Réseau Les codes correcteurs et les codes détecteurs Claude
Le CRC (Cycle Redundancy Check) : un code détecteur un mot de code 15 − 11 a un coefficient d'efficacité de 11/15 = 73 , un mot de Exercice : y a-t-il une erreur dans le mot suivant ? 1 0 1 0 1 1 Exercice (Correction) 1 0 1 0 1 |
Corrigés exercices codes correcteurs - LIRMM
Le code par parité impaire n'est pas linéaire, sa capacité de détection est de 1 bit , pour tout n Exercice 4: a: toute erreur sur un nombre impair de bit Pas de |
Codes détecteurs et correcteurs B Rouzeyre - LIRMM
J Badrikian, Technosup, Ellipses (cours et exercices) ▫ Codes correcteurs : Théorie et Codes cycliques CRC/FCS, code BCH, Reed-Salomon Conclusion : si on détecte une erreur, on corrige vers le code demandant le moins de |
Code derreur (Parité, Hamming, CRC) - Congduc Pham
Vérifier que l'on corrige bien 1 erreur: exemple, le bit 7 (numérotation de droite `a gauche, en commençant par 0) du 'e' est mal reçu Exercice 4 Donner la matrice |
Cours 3 detection-correction erreur - Les pages perso du LIG
Code correcteur coûte cher (en terme quantité d'information rajoutée) Exemple : Ethernet utilise un champs CRC à 32 bits, Compression ZIP types d'erreur peut on détecter ? • Peut on corriger des erreurs ? Si oui comment ? Exercice 25 |
Protocoles réseaux TD no 1 : Codes détecteurs Codes - IRIF
Un code est une fonction C qui a tout mot de m bits associe un mot de n bits, n>m On note r = n−m Exercice 2 : bit de parité Exercice 3 : codes CRC 1 |
CRC - Ensiwiki
Codes correcteurs : Code linéaire, Reed Solomon 76 Exercice: construire le circuit de codage et décodage pour CRC-16 X25-CCITT Corrige 1 erreur |
Techniques de détection & de correction des erreurs de - LIPN
Codes de parité ◇ Code polynomiale (CRC) □ Codes auto-correcteurs : code de Hamming Certaines erreurs détectées ne peuvent pas être corrigées |
Transmission et codage - IGM
Quelle doit être la distance de Hamming minimale d'un code détecteur de k erreurs ? Exercice 8 On utilise pour une transmission avec detection d'erreur un CRC |